The Chuango PIR-926 is an advanced passive infrared (PIR) motion sensor designed for outdoor security applications. It features patented infrared technology, fuzzy logic, and a sophisticated algorithm to accurately detect human body movements while effectively reducing interference and false alarms. Its dual detection capability, combining infrared and microwave sensing, enhances reliability. Equipped with a solar panel and a waterproof housing, this sensor is ideal for various outdoor environments.

4.2 Optimal Placement Guidelines

To ensure accurate detection and prevent false alarms, adhere to the following placement recommendations:

  • Igbesoke Giga: Install the sensor at approximately 2 meters (6.5 feet) from the ground for optimal detection coverage.
  • Agbegbe Iwari: Position the sensor to cover the desired area, typically up to 8 meters with a 110-degree angle. Ensure the detection path is clear of obstructions.
  • Ifojusi Imọlẹ Oorun: Mount the sensor in a location that receives direct sunlight for several hours a day to ensure the solar panel can effectively charge the internal battery.
  • Yago fun Awọn Idilọwọ: Do not install the sensor where large objects like trees, bushes, or structures might block its field of view or cause false triggers due to movement.
  • Ajesara Pet: While the sensor has advanced algorithms, avoid placing it at heights or angles where pets might frequently trigger it, especially if they are large.
  • No Direct Heat Sources: Avoid pointing the sensor directly at heat sources, reflective surfaces, or areas with rapid temperature changes, as this can lead to false alarms.

5. Awọn ilana Iṣiṣẹ

Once installed, the PIR-926 operates automatically. The solar panel continuously charges the internal battery, ensuring continuous operation.

  • Muu ṣiṣẹ: The sensor is designed to be always active, detecting motion within its specified range.
  • Iwari: When motion is detected, the sensor will trigger an alarm signal to a compatible security system. The LED indicator may flash briefly upon detection.
  • Isakoso Agbara: The integrated solar panel charges the 3.7V 1800mAh lithium battery during daylight hours. The sensor can operate for up to 150 days on standby without direct sunlight once fully charged.
